恭喜,你发布的帖子
发布于 2015-10-27 20:16:50
6楼
请教一个关于工业以太网的问题,我厂有一台s7-400PLC,通过CP443-1与上位机os1,os2进行通讯,由于电脑使用时限过久,我们于去年对os2站电脑进行更换,按照原来配置进行通讯,没有任何问题,但是os1今年更换时,也是按照原来配置,发现无法连接到plc,后经检查发现,os1在配置以太网通讯采用了MAC地址进行寻址,而os2是通过IP寻址的,所以我们又把原来的网卡更换到os1问题才得以解决。
所以我希望了解IP寻址和MAC地址寻址在实际通讯中有何区别?需要考虑哪些因素。谢谢
你说你更换OS后不能通信但是我感觉更换OS后与OS的MAC地址无关,除非PLC不是通过标准的西门子驱动通信的按常理WINCC用ISO是用02连接资源也就是OP那么他与PLC的MAC地址有关与OS的MAC地址没有什么关系不知道是你交换机设定的问题还是你不是用的WINCC。
MAC是记录在交换机的MAC表里面的一个东西以端口为主记录对应终端的MAC地址,而IP是为了方便管理网络进而规划的一个地址,IP地址对应的是一个MAC地址,他的关系就像域名与IP一样,MAC地址是OSI网络模型的第二层所以也叫一般的交换机叫二层交换机,IP地址是OSI网络模型的第三层也叫三层交换机或路由器。
果你的OS1不与其他第三方Ethernet的站点通信那么你完全可以如改为TCP/IP,通过ISO无需IP也就是省了一个IP地址,当然有些设备考虑其安全性用ISO基于MAC通讯更加安全一点因为IP别人可以攻击可能会有冲突而MAC地址就不一样了,每个网络设备都有一个MAC地址,网络硬件唯一的地址。
请填写推广理由:
分享
只看
楼主